Alexander Ramsey and the Dakota Bounty
Sunday, June 22, 2 pm
Colette Routel, Associate Professor at William Mitchell College of Law, will provide a detailed account of the creation of the Minnesota bounty system in 1863, its implementation, and the court case that finally ended it. Scouts and citizens were paid up to $200 for proof they had killed a Dakota. House tours at 1:30 and 3:30 pm. Suggested donation $2, youth through high school and PDHS members are free.
